Definition
Smooth muscle is a type of muscle tissue found in the walls of internal organs like the stomach, intestines, and blood vessels. Unlike skeletal muscle, it's involuntary, meaning you can't consciously control it. Think of it as the silent operator 🤫 inside your body. It contracts slowly and rhythmically, controlling functions like digestion and blood pressure. Smooth muscle cells are spindle-shaped and lack the striated appearance of skeletal muscle. They play a vital role in maintaining bodily functions without your direct input 😌.
